WSU strategic plan has four themes

• Exceptional research, innovation, and creative activity

• Transformative student experience

• Outreach and engagement

• Institutional effectiveness: diversity, integrity, and openness

Page 3: Discussion with Erica Austin, Interim Co-Provost W ASHINGTON S TATE U NIVERSITY Presented to: Administrative Professional Advisory Council October 8, 2015.

WSU is committed to taking research to the “next level”

• WSU Strategic Plan tasks the VPR to “identify areas of research excellence and emerging areas requiring additional investment to achieve national and international prominence.”

• The “WSU 120-Day Study” defines the strategic agenda for WSU research, and includes 19 specific recommendations focused on implementation.

WSU Grand Challenges

Sustaining Health: Healthier People and Communities

Sustainable Resources for Society: Food, Energy, Water

Advancing an Educated, Informed, and Equitable Society

Improving Quality of Life through Smart Systems

Fundamental Research in Support of National Security
